Replacing IP address in URL

I'm decent at making websites but need help with some server basics. 


On all of my MDD sites the url starts with the IP address. Is there a way to hide the IP address, or replace it with a domain name?  I've used URL masking but dislike the way it is implemented in that it messes up my media queries.



- James